§ 63.034 — REFUSAL OR REVOCATION OF PERMIT
AG § 63.034Title 5. PRODUCTION, PROCESSING, AND SALE OF HORTICULTURAL PRODUCTS · Part A. SEED AND FERTILIZER · Ch. 63. COMMERCIAL FERTILIZER · Art. C. PERMIT AND REGISTRATION
Statute text
View on sourceFollowing notice and a hearing, the service may revoke, suspend, annul, or amend an existing permit or may refuse to issue a permit if it finds that the permittee or applicant has:
(1)been convicted of a crime for which a permit may be revoked, suspended, annulled, amended, or refused under Chapter 53, Occupations Code;
(2)refused or after notice failed to comply with this chapter and rules adopted under this chapter; or
(3)used fraudulent or deceptive practices in attempting evasion of this chapter or a rule adopted under this chapter.
Legislative history
Acts 1981, 67th Leg., p. 1144, ch. 388, Sec. 1, eff. Sept. 1, 1981. Amended by Acts 1983, 68th Leg., p. 1842, ch. 349, art. 1, Sec. 2, eff. Sept. 1, 1983; Acts 2001, 77th Leg., ch. 1420, Sec. 14.721, eff. Sept. 1, 2001.
